    How do I know if a new Solibri update version is backwards compatible?

    Some background on this question.
    I share my SMC file with third parties. And I got feedback in December that I updated without notifying them. And they could not read my file anymore. Because they couldn’t use my SMC file anymore (from update 9.13.023 to 9.13.1).update.png
    So I decided to keep an older version on a separate computer just in case. Last week there was a new update (from 9.13.1 to 9.13.2). But after a quick test, this version was backwards compatible.
    These third parties had an even older version 9.12.9.13. But I still don’t understand why they could use my SMC until version 9.13.023. There’s nothing about it in the release notes.

      Hello @teun_1!

      Thanks for your message. While 9.13 is compatible with older Solibri versions, 9.13 does bring in support for additional IFC4 components, which are not supported in previous Solibri versions.

      More informaiton on these are available in the Release notes.
